iol Motoring Reviews The Topless Two Seat MINI

South Africa's iol Motoring reviews the new MINI Roadster.  It observes, in part:
With its top down, the Roadster effortlessly melds signature Mini front-end styling with a classic barchetta (little boat) profile, the waistline gently rising to meet a flat rear deck.

Roof up, it becomes a rather silly little three-box coupé that looks more French than English from a rear three-quarter angle.
